> When I try to connect from a remote machine to my one at home
> using ssh I get the error message "ssh: connect to host 64.146.133.1 port
> 22: Connection refused" -- but using ssh in the outgoing direction (i.e.
> from home to the remote location) works fine.  Any suggestions as to how
> to troubleshoot this?

Hi Jerry,

I looked at your IP to see what kind of router you had.
It appears to be supplied by your ISP, because telnet showed:

Sawtooth Technologies, LLC  Stevenson, WA    Unauthorized Access is Prohibited
gw-sawtooth.pdx.rain.net       98.10.20-0    For Service Call  +1 509 427-4865
Sawtooth Technologies Ether 204.119.0.254    PL/DHGL/109201/ELG   204.119.4.30

So you may need to call them to get the password or to forward port 22
for you.
